    had 2 vt1100's that I put over 100,000 miles on each of them. Alternator stators needed replacement at about the mileage you are at on both bikes . Also the hose coming off the radiator overflow tank is routed very close to the rear cylinder head . the hose starts leaking when it bakes and eventually cracks. I always carry a spare radiator fan switch.
